Transaction ed2ff5d66e4080c4d62987e2594db780b0e627715a27d9265df1ba1d63d3e6b0
1 Input
1 Output
-
ed2ff5d66e4080c4d62987e2594db780b0e627715a27d9265df1ba1d63d3e6b0:0
- value
- 29322220
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a43073d348afd199e40cdac25479d4cb64b1497 OP_EQUAL
- address
- 9zfXmrtB6N8rcYGKH6DPhXbjm5gReEL21s